burn in in American English
to darken (certain areas on a print produced from a photographic negative) by exposing them to more light to expose (one part of an image) to more light by masking the other parts in order to darken and give greater detail to the unmasked area burn in in British English verb: to darken (areas on a photographic print) by exposing them to light while masking other regions |
